Changes for version 0.09 - 2014-07-08

  • another fix for 09_client_server_tcp.t (check features of Net::SSLeay)
  • updated extract_* scripts
  • updated HTTP/2 to draft 13
    • removed ALTSVC and BLOCKED frames
    • removed DATA frames comression support
    • PAD_HIGH, PAD_LOW flags are replaced by PADDED
    • settings changed from 8-bit to 16-bit unsigned integer
  • updated HPACK to draft 08
    • updated huffman codes table
    • updated static table
  • fixed tests

Modules

HTTP/2 protocol (draft 13) implementation
HTTP/2 client
HTTP/2 server

Provides

in lib/Protocol/HTTP2/Connection.pm
in lib/Protocol/HTTP2/Constants.pm
in lib/Protocol/HTTP2/Frame.pm
in lib/Protocol/HTTP2/Frame/Continuation.pm
in lib/Protocol/HTTP2/Frame/Data.pm
in lib/Protocol/HTTP2/Frame/Goaway.pm
in lib/Protocol/HTTP2/Frame/Headers.pm
in lib/Protocol/HTTP2/Frame/Ping.pm
in lib/Protocol/HTTP2/Frame/Priority.pm
in lib/Protocol/HTTP2/Frame/Push_promise.pm
in lib/Protocol/HTTP2/Frame/Rst_stream.pm
in lib/Protocol/HTTP2/Frame/Settings.pm
in lib/Protocol/HTTP2/Frame/Window_update.pm
in lib/Protocol/HTTP2/HeaderCompression.pm
in lib/Protocol/HTTP2/Huffman.pm
in lib/Protocol/HTTP2/HuffmanCodes.pm
in lib/Protocol/HTTP2/StaticTable.pm
in lib/Protocol/HTTP2/Stream.pm
in lib/Protocol/HTTP2/Trace.pm
in lib/Protocol/HTTP2/Upgrade.pm